Flavio Pendolino received his Ph.D. in Physics and Nanotechnology from Universidad Autonoma de Madrid (UAM), Spain. He is an auditor of quality and environmental management systems in the industrial sector. His major interest is in nanotechnology applied to environmental issues, besides synthesis of graphene oxide and its modification for remediation processes. Nerina Armata received her Ph.D. in Chemistry from the University of Palermo, Italy. She is a research fellow at the same University and her research interests are on modeling and computational chemistry techniques to the study of nanostructures and molecules/polymers with environment impact.
State of the art.- Synthesis, characterization and models of graphene oxide.- Regulation and Environmental aspects of Graphene Oxide.- Remediation Process in Graphene Oxide.- Outlook.
